This is the syllabus for the first semester of undergraduate syntax at NYU.
I would be happy to discuss it with people who are interested. I have two
main guidelines:
a. I try to use Merge as a pedagogical tool throughout the semester.
b. I try to make the course as hands-on as possible, with in-class activities.
Syllabus: Grammatical Analysis I (Spring 2025)
Abstract: I argue for eliminating the operation of Agree. Agreement in natural language is instead analyzed in terms external Merge of agreement morphemes and the theory of copies and repetitions developed in Chomsky 2024.
Keywords: Agree, Merge, copies, repetitions
